Claudia Winkleman and Mika are back with a new series of The Piano as they discover "unbelievable" talent with new mentor Jon Batiste
-
With her sharp wit, self-deprecating humour and conspiratorial charm, Claudia Winkleman is one of our brightest and most brilliant TV presenters.
However, as she filmed the new series of The Piano, she admits her cool facade crumbled and she couldn't help but be overcome by emotion. “I cried three times,” Claudia says. “The finalists are unbelievable.”
Channel 4's Bafta-nominated and Broadcast Award-winning show is back for a third series, with five fresh locations, including Heathrow Airport.
There's another big change too — multi-Grammy-winning musician Jon Batiste replaces pianist Lang Lang.
According to fellow mentor and Grace Kelly singer Mika, the shake-up has given the show a new lease of life.
“It has a different energy this year than the past two years,” says Mika. “It’s obviously because Jon is around and it's taken a whole new shape in terms of the discussions and the considerations.
“Putting someone else into the show was a really good disturbance, a really great exercise — emotionally, stylistically, culturally. Some things would clash, some things were in complete harmony, and it’s all in there.”
